摘要

Aim at improvement leaching reaction and heatrntransfer efficiency, A novel self-stirring tubular reactorrndriven by pressure energy used in bauxite digestionrnprocess was presented originally by NortheasternrnUniversity, which combined the advantages ofrnautoclaves and conventional tubular digestionrnequipment. Quasi-logarithmic equation between thernstirring speed and the various factors was establishedrnby dimensional analysis method. The resultsrndemonstrated that higher pressure promoted thernappearance of more obvious turbulence and improvedrnthe mixing effect of media in the reactor. Thernquasi-logarithmic equation between the stirring speedrnand the various factors was:rnN = 356.7053 ρ~(-0.43227)μ ~(0.13546) P~(0.56773)H~(-0.86454).rnrnrnrnrnrn℃
